From 2f54a2ed3e37cbb6af7a14829fe3fb17502cb6ab Mon Sep 17 00:00:00 2001 From: Andrew Branson Date: Wed, 24 Jul 2013 16:28:10 +0200 Subject: SchemaVersion is actually a string property. Probably shouldn't be though. --- src/main/java/com/c2kernel/lifecycle/instance/Activity.java |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/main/java/com/c2kernel/lifecycle/instance/Activity.java') diff --git a/src/main/java/com/c2kernel/lifecycle/instance/Activity.java b/src/main/java/com/c2kernel/lifecycle/instance/Activity.java index b67b472..2384dc3 100644 --- a/src/main/java/com/c2kernel/lifecycle/instance/Activity.java +++ b/src/main/java/com/c2kernel/lifecycle/instance/Activity.java @@ -526,8 +526,8 @@ public class Activity extends WfVertex hist = (History) Gateway.getStorage().get(entityPath.getSysKey(), ClusterStorage.HISTORY, this); if (hasOutcome) { String schemaName = isError?"Errors":(String)getProperties().get("SchemaType"); - Integer schemaVersion = isError?0:(Integer)getProperties().get("SchemaVersion"); - event = hist.addEvent(agent.getAgentName(), getCurrentAgentRole(), transitionID, getName(), getPath(), getType(), schemaName, schemaVersion, viewName, getCurrentState()); + String schemaVersion = isError?"0":(String)getProperties().get("SchemaVersion"); + event = hist.addEvent(agent.getAgentName(), getCurrentAgentRole(), transitionID, getName(), getPath(), getType(), schemaName, Integer.valueOf(schemaVersion), viewName, getCurrentState()); } else event = hist.addEvent(agent.getAgentName(), getCurrentAgentRole(), transitionID, getName(), getPath(), getType(), getCurrentState()); -- cgit v1.2.3